My server has broken down, backups exist on a ftp server, but now I cannot restore the domain on the new server. Although server settings and all are restored, the final step exits with the error in the log Execution of /opt/psa/admin/plib/api-cli/domain_pref.php --update amklassiek.nl -default_server_mysql localhost:3306 -ignore-nonexistent-options failed with return code 1. Stderr is You can set the default database server parameter for subscriptions only.

My old server has been fully replaced and cannot be reached anymore. My new server has the same ip number as the old.

Plz. help.
 
However transfering the backup to another server with another ip does work. But it has to go to the new server with the same ip as the old.
